Latest Patents
Among his latest contributions are two significant patents that showcase his inventive capabilities. The first is an **Endovascular Navigation System and Method**, which features an elongate flexible member designed to access the venous vasculature of a patient. This system includes a sensor at its distal end that detects physiological characteristics, a processor that analyzes the data, and a display that visually indicates the position of the device within the vascular structure.
The second patent is for **Apparatus and Methods for Closing Vessels**. This invention provides a unique mechanism involving a needle with a specialized lumen, which accommodates a compressible clip designed to close tubular structures within a patient's body. The clip can switch between a relaxed and a stressed state, enabling efficient deployment for medical procedures.
